Air Jacketed CO2 Incubator 31-ACI101 is designed with a chamber volume of 155 liters, providing ample space for reliable and stable operation. It has 3 shelves, allowing organized and efficient use of the chamber space. Integrated temperature control from RT + 5 to 55 ℃ for precise environment regulation. Incorporated microprocessor-based PID controller for accurate and stable temperature and CO2 regulation. Our Air Jacketed CO2 Incubator is ideal for tissue engineering, stem cell research, cancer investigations, and mammalian cell cultivation.
Specifications
| Chamber Volume | 155 L |
| Shelves | 3 (pcs) |
| Heating Method | Air-Jacketed, PID Control |
| Temperature Range | RT + 5 to 55 ℃ |
| Ambient Temperature | RT + 5 to 30 ℃ |
| Temperature Stability | ± 0.1 ℃ |
| CO2 Range | 0 to 20 % V/V |
| CO2 Control Resolution | ± 0.1 % (IR sensor) |
| CO2 Recovery | (Door Open 30 s, Recovery to 5 %) ≤ 3 min |
| Temperature Recovery | Temperature Recovery (Door Open 30 s, Recovery to 37 ℃ ) ≤ 8 min |
| Humidity Method | Natural Vaporization > 90 % |
| Power Consumption | 750 W |
| Power Supply | AC 220 V / 50 Hz |
| Interior Dimension | 480 × 530 × 610 mm |
| Exterior Dimension | 670 × 767 × 880 mm |
| Net Weight | 85 Kg |
| Gross Weight | 127 Kg |

Lab Expo Air Jacketed CO₂ Incubator supports controlled cell culture workflows where uniform temperature stability and precise CO₂ regulation are required to maintain consistent growth conditions. The system operates with an air-jacket heating design to ensure even thermal distribution and microprocessor-regulated CO₂ control for stable pH maintenance. Stainless steel or copper interiors support hygienic operation, while HEPA filtration and UV sterilization provide contamination control for precise, repeatable incubation performance.
